Crosslink Capital's Q4 2014 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2014, Crosslink Capital held 54 positions worth $720M, down 7.8% from $781M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 56% of the portfolio.

Crosslink Capital withdrew a net $41.5M in Q4 2014, closing 10 positions and reducing 22 holdings. Its most notable exit was ServiceNow, an estimated $18.5M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 40% of assets, up from 33% a quarter earlier, followed by Communication Services and Real Estate.

Against the trend, Crosslink Capital opened a new position in Carbonite Inc worth $29.8M.
